On 13 April 1919, Jallianwala Bagh massacre took place in Amritsar, Punjab where Colonel Reginald Dyer ordered troops of the British Indian Army to start firing into a crowd of Indians. There were about 25,000 people present in Jallianwala Bagh at the time of firing. Some tried to escape while some jumped in the well built in the premises of Jallianwala Bagh to save themselves from getting shot.
